Jets holdout Haason Reddick stiffed biz partner of $1.6M and hired goons to intimidate him: suit
Briefly

Micah Khan states in court documents, "Wright and Matthews had no experience operating a home health agency and as a result the business was operating at a loss with zero patients." This highlights the mismanagement of Haven Home Health Agency by Reddick's family after its purchase.
Khan claimed, "While Reddick devoted little to no time to building Haven, I made making Haven a successful company my primary goal, working full-time on Haven's behalf," underscoring his contribution to the business compared to Reddick's negligence.
